Graphic Communication Schools in Tennessee
65 Graphic Communication students earned their degrees in the state in 2022-2023.
Gender Distribution
In Tennessee, a graphic communication major is more popular with women than with men.

Racial Distribution
The racial distribution of graphic communication majors in Tennessee is as follows:
- Asian: 3.1%
- Black or African American: 9.2%
- Hispanic or Latino: 7.7%
- White: 76.9%
- Non-Resident Alien: 0.0%
- Other Races: 3.1%

Jobs for Graphic Communication Grads in Tennessee
In this state, there are 9,190 people employed in jobs related to a graphic communication degree, compared to 426,290 nationwide.

Wages for Graphic Communication Jobs in Tennessee
In this state, graphic communication grads earn an average of $37,480. Nationwide, they make an average of $38,470.
